Company officials shocked the world Sept. 30 with its immediate withdrawal ofVioxx, a COX-2 inhibitor, from the world market citing patient concern. The arthritis and acute pain drug was the company's best selling product, generating $2.5 billion sales in 2003, 11 percent of Merck's total revenues
